COINOTAG News, citing The Block, reports that the United States’ first Solana spot ETF, BSOL, began trading with notable momentum. Among roughly 850 new ETFs this year, the listing stands out, signaling growing demand for Solana exposure via a regulated vehicle.

On Wednesday, BSOL’s turnover hit $72.4 million, topping day one’s $56 million. Bloomberg ETF analyst Eric Balchunas called the figure highly impressive and a positive sign. Other debuts, LTCC and HBR, drew about $8 million and $1 million, respectively.

Grayscale’s GSOL posted roughly $4 million in initial flow. Balchunas cited the early strength of BSOL as a function of timing. The SSK (REX Osprey Solana Staking ETF) attracted about $18 million on day two, highlighting solid investor interest in the sector.
